小型智能电子产品开发案例教程,从零到一的实战指南

文文 602 0

本文目录导读:

小型智能电子产品开发案例教程,从零到一的实战指南

  1. 小型智能电子产品的市场机遇与开发价值
  2. 开发流程:系统化拆解与步骤指南

小型智能电子产品的市场机遇与开发价值

随着物联网技术的普及,小型智能电子产品(如智能手环、小型智能音箱、环境监测设备等)正成为智能家居、个人健康、工业监测等领域的“毛细血管”,市场需求持续增长,这类产品通常体积小巧、功能聚焦、开发周期短、成本可控,非常适合个人开发者、小型团队或初创企业快速切入市场,同时也能提升技术能力、验证产品概念,本文以“智能手环”为案例,系统介绍小型智能电子产品开发的流程、工具、注意事项及实战经验,助力读者从零到一打造属于自己的智能硬件产品。

开发流程:系统化拆解与步骤指南

小型智能电子产品开发并非“一蹴而就”,需遵循“需求分析→硬件选型→硬件设计→软件开发→测试优化→量产准备”的系统流程,确保每个环节环环相扣。

需求分析与功能定义

开发前,需明确产品的目标用户(如健身爱好者、老年人、办公室白领)、核心功能(如心率监测、步数统计、消息提醒、环境感知等)及技术指标(如续航时间、传感器精度、通信距离),智能手环的核心需求是“实时心率监测+步数统计+手机消息提醒”,技术指标包括:续航≥7天、心率误差≤5%、蓝牙连接稳定(距离≥10米)。

硬件选型:性能与成本的平衡

硬件选型是产品的基础,需综合考虑性能、功耗、成本、尺寸等因素,以智能手环为例,关键元器件选型建议:

  • 主控芯片:优先选择集成Wi-Fi/蓝牙的芯片(如ESP32、nRF52840),兼顾通信与低功耗;若需更高性能,可选择STM32系列(如STM32F401)。
  • 传感器:心率传感器(PPG,如MAX30102)、加速度计(MPU6050,用于步数计算)、温度传感器(DHT11/DHT22,可选),根据功能需求选择。
  • 通信模块:蓝牙4.2(低功耗蓝牙,适合短距离通信),若需联网,可增加Wi-Fi模块(如ESP32自带的Wi-Fi)。
  • 电源管理:锂电池(300mAh-500mAh,根据续航需求选择)、充电模块(U-C,支持快充)。

硬件设计:电路与结构规划

硬件设计包括电路原理图绘制(用Altium Designer、Fritzing或KiCad等工具)和PCB设计(选择单层或双层板,考虑元器件布局与布线),智能手环的电路设计需连接传感器、主控、电池、充电模块,并预留蓝牙天线接口,结构设计需考虑人体工程学(如佩戴舒适度)、电池仓空间、按键位置等。

软件开发:固件与APP协同

软件开发分为固件开发(主控芯片的驱动、逻辑处理)和APP开发(用户交互界面),需结合云平台实现数据存储与远程控制。

  • 固件开发:使用Arduino IDE(针对ESP32)或ESP-IDF(更专业的固件框架),编写传感器数据采集、数据处理(如步数计算、心率分析)、蓝牙通信代码,心率数据采集后需通过滤波算法(如移动平均滤波)降低噪声,再计算心率值。

留言评论